WebWith disability insurance, you could still receive a paycheck when you’re out of work on maternity leave. It’s important to purchase disability insurance before you become pregnant, as pregnancy will be considered a pre-existing condition and may not be covered. WebShort-term disability insurance can cover some aspects of maternity leave, but it depends on the specific policy and the state you live in. In some states, short-term disability insurance may be required to cover a portion of your maternity leave. WebPregnancy Insurance. Pregnancy insurance is one of the best ways to minimize the expenses that will come with your prenatal care and the hospital stay when you give birth. If you don’t have maternity insurance, you can anticipate spending around $10,000-$12,000. In 2011, the average cost of labor and vaginal delivery in a hospital was $10,657.
